Post travels to Montana

The Post traveled to Lo Lo Hot Springs Montana over spring break with the Drier family—Andy, Valerie, and their sons, Joseph, age 10, and Benjamin, age 8. They were there visiting with family.

“It was a first plane trip with our boys and they loved it,” said Valerie. “We did lots of hikes and snowmobiled on top of mountains. Such a beautiful area. We then traveled to Glacier for an overnight stay at a beautiful log home. A lot of Glacier was st

ill closed but we still did a nice hike in the park and got some gorgeous photos. We ended our trip by backpacking, snowshoeing up a mountain, and building our own snow fort with a bed of pine needle branches to sleep on. We slept outdoors and luckily had great weather, with a view of the stars that we probably won’t see again. What an adventure!”
